Flinn Scientific at a glance

What we know about Flinn Scientific

What they do

Flinn Scientific, Inc., based in Batavia, Illinois, is a comprehensive multi-line supplier of manufactured and purchased science education products and curricula. Flinn's products and curricula, many of which are proprietary and sold under the "Flinn Scientific" brand, are distributed to high school and middle school science teachers throughout the United States. Since its founding in 1977, as a laboratory chemicals supplier to high school science teachers, Flinn has continuously expanded its product lines and markets and has developed an intensely loyal, growing base of science teacher customers across all 50 states. In 1977, the company was founded as a family-owned and ¬operated business by a mother, father and two sons. The family established the tone and culture for the company. Their entrepreneurial spirit has been the basis for every process and system in the company. The company's success in serving the science education market is reflected in the results of surveys conducted by Education Market Research, an independent research company. For the past 11 years, Flinn Scientific has repeatedly earned the distinction of being rated in surveys as the #1 "most preferred science supplier" by science educators nationwide. In the fall of 2014, the Flinn brothers retired and the company was acquired by Windjammer, a private equity group. Recognizing Flinn Scientific's strong brand recognition for outstanding quality and unparalleled service, Windjammer is committed to building upon the solid foundation created by the Flinn family. Newly enacted initiatives have already been successful in growing the business since 2014. The ongoing success of Flinn Scientific has created new opportunities for talented people interested in joining a company on its path of long-term sustainable growth.

Autonomous Inventory Replenishment and Demand Forecasting Agent

For a mid-size supplier like Flinn, managing thousands of SKUs—from delicate chemicals to bulky lab equipment—requires precise inventory control. Overstocking ties up capital, while stockouts disrupt critical school lab schedules. Traditional manual forecasting often fails to account for seasonal spikes in the academic calendar. AI agents can analyze historical order data, school enrollment trends, and regional academic schedules to predict demand with high granularity. This reduces carrying costs and ensures that proprietary curricula and essential supplies are available exactly when teachers need them, protecting the brand's reputation for unparalleled service.

Up to 20% reduction in excess inventorySupply Chain Management Review
The agent monitors ERP data in real-time, cross-referencing sales velocity with lead times from suppliers. It autonomously generates purchase orders for approval when stock thresholds are hit based on predictive models rather than static reorder points. It integrates directly with the warehouse management system to adjust safety stock levels based on seasonal volatility, ensuring the Batavia facility maintains optimal throughput.

Automated Regulatory Compliance and Safety Data Sheet (SDS) Management

Distributing laboratory chemicals requires strict adherence to safety regulations and constant updates to Safety Data Sheets (SDS). Manual tracking of regulatory changes across 50 states is labor-intensive and carries high liability risk. AI agents can monitor federal and state chemical safety databases, automatically flagging products that require updated documentation or restricted shipping protocols. This ensures Flinn remains compliant with evolving standards without diverting senior staff time from core educational business functions, maintaining the trust of science educators nationwide.

40% reduction in compliance audit preparation timeIndustry Compliance Benchmarking Report
The agent periodically scrapes regulatory databases for chemical classification updates. When a change is detected, it triggers an automated workflow to update the digital SDS library on the company website and notifies relevant internal teams. It also audits outbound shipping manifests against updated hazardous material regulations, preventing non-compliant shipments before they leave the facility.

Automated Order Processing and Exception Management Agent

Manual order entry and error correction are significant bottlenecks in mid-size distribution operations. Inaccurate orders lead to costly returns and frustrated teachers. An AI agent can ingest orders from various formats—including PDFs, web forms, and EDI—validating them against inventory and pricing databases in real-time. By handling the majority of routine processing and flagging only genuine exceptions for human review, the company can significantly speed up order-to-delivery cycles, ensuring that science classrooms are equipped on time, every time.

50% reduction in order processing errorsAssociation for Operations Management
The agent uses computer vision and NLP to extract data from incoming purchase orders. It performs a three-way match between the order, the current inventory, and the customer's pricing agreement. If all data points align, the agent pushes the order directly into the fulfillment system. If discrepancies arise, it creates a concise summary for a human agent, highlighting exactly what needs correction.
